Job Summary

As a Supply Planning Manager for Parfums Christian Dior you will be strategically managing and optimizing supply chain processes to ensure product availability while meticulously controlling costs.

You will be a pivotal force collaborating closely with diverse stakeholders including French production teams US warehouse operations and local Brand Sales and Marketing teams to guarantee the seamless delivery of our established products catalog and exciting new Launches. 

You will be accountable for maintaining robust inventory health implementing proactive strategies and leading initiatives that optimize stock quality and minimize financial impact.

PRINCIPA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Supply planning Management
    • Proactively monitor and optimize supply planning strategies and inventory levels to meet ambitious service targets.
    • Develop and report key performance indicators (KPIs) to Senior Leadership HQ and Brand partners driving performance metrics such as OTIF Service Level Fulfillment Presence Rate and Cuts.
    • Conduct in-depth root cause analysis for service disruptions implementing robust preventative processes and continuous improvement initiatives.
    • Monitor and challenge the Air/Sea (RAMA) ratio actively seeking to minimize environmental impact from air shipments.
  • Novelty Launch Execution & Coordination:
    • Drive flawless execution of new product launches translating allocation plans forecasted into actionable supply strategies.
    • Proactively assess and mitigate delay risks escalating alerts to Central and Local Management with strategic recommendations.
    • Orchestrate cross-functional coordination with supply chain stakeholders to ensure comprehensive visibility and activate necessary levers for successful launches.
    • Rigorously monitor consumption patterns and challenge forecast accuracy during critical launch periods (M1-M3) identifying early signals for demand adjustments in partnership with the Forecaster Manager in the team
    • Lead the coordination of novelty projects ensuring right execution with local and central stakeholders.
    • Track and report KPIs on novelty execution including on-time delivery consumption rates and air/sea shipment ratio driving efficiency and responsiveness
  • Strategic Inventory Management: 
    • Champion inventory health actively managing overstock Days of Inventory/Coverage (DOI/DOC) and identifying unneeded inventory. Implement actions to mitigate obsolescence risks.
    • Oversee the destruction process for short-term obsolescence suggesting alternative usage and meticulously monitoring destruction lists.
    • Lead monthly Stock Reviews projecting inventory levels and reporting projections risks and opportunities to Finance to master P&L impact.
